Amazing American Cuisine (USA's best kept secret)

A certain Mr Farrier has tracked down a 10 list of (some of) the best American cuisine of all time, namely The Top 10 Foods Only America Could Have Invented...

When it comes to food, America gets a bad rap. It’s a common refrain that America has no cuisine to call our own. We’ve got apple pie and hot dogs, but that’s about it...

But the truth is, America does have a cuisine to call it’s own. Over the past 232 years we’ve invented some of the most creative, daring, and yes, downright craziest dishes the world has ever seen.

Sure, they can be overly greasy, a little too cheesy, and sometimes fried a few times too many. But they’re ours.

So to celebrate Independence Day, we’ve put together this list of the best foods that only a country with just the right combination of greed, grit, and gluttony could have possibly dreamed up.
My favourites (and the ones I try to have every trip to the United States) are #10. Corn Dog (a summer camp staple), #9. Philly Cheesesteak (thanks to little Bill at Appel Farm camp for that one), #7. S'mores (another amazing invention I was introduced to at Appel Farm), and #1. Chocolate Chip Cookie Dough Ice Cream.

While I can do without the battered deep fried veges (thanks Stagedoor Manor ;-), I do have a number of other essential American tastes I make sure I never miss when I'm over there...
Taco Bell is always on the list, along with Midnight Milky Way Bars (that's a dark chocolate Mars Bar to non-US people), and Ben & Jerry's Ice cream (particularly the Phish Food flavour - again, thanks to little Bill for introducing kiwi Joe and I to that one... "Chocolate Ice Cream, Marshmallow, Caramel & Chocolatey Chunks!!").

Aw, just look at what I'm missing out on with being stuck in snowy New Zealand this winter, when I could be sampling this awesomely unique cuisine in sunny North America!
